Course Content


• Data Collection and Integration for Air Quality Monitoring Systems •
• Network Infrastructure Design for IoT Devices in Air Quality Monitoring •
• Cloud Computing for Data Storage and Analysis in Air Quality Monitoring •
• Cybersecurity Measures for Protecting Air Quality Monitoring Systems •
• Sensor Technology and Calibration for Accurate Air Quality Data •
• Data Visualization Tools for Effective Communication of Air Quality Data •
• Wireless Communication Protocols for IoT Devices in Air Quality Monitoring •
• System Maintenance and Troubleshooting for Air Quality Monitoring Systems •
• Environmental Factors Affecting Air Quality Monitoring Systems •
• Regulatory Compliance for Air Quality Monitoring Systems
